MaestraPeace is more than a mural—it’s a monumental tribute to women’s strength, struggle, and resistance. Created in 1994 by seven Bay Area women muralists, it stands as a powerful exhibition of women’s artistry and a celebration of our stories. As its stewards, we—The Women’s Building—hold the responsibility to preserve this living symbol of collective memory. Preserving MaestraPeace demands skilled care and real resources.
